Wood Flooring Replacement in Plano, TX
Wood flooring replacement services involve removing existing hardwood floors and installing new ones to update the appearance and functionality of a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including complete floor overhauls, repairing damaged sections, or upgrading to different wood types or finishes. Homeowners often seek this service when their current flooring shows signs of wear, warping, or damage, or when planning a renovation to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a space.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of wood available, and the finishes that best suit their interior design. Factors such as the condition of the existing subfloor, the style of wood flooring, and the expected durability are important considerations before requesting a replacement. Clarifying these details can help ensure the new flooring meets both functional needs and personal preferences.
Many property owners in Plano, TX look into Wood Flooring Replacement for repairs, replacements, upgrades, and appearance-related improvements.

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Common options include oak, maple, hickory, and exotic hardwoods, suitable for various interior styles.
When is replacement necessary instead of repair? Replacement is recommended when flooring is severely damaged, warped, or extensively worn beyond repair.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ood flooring? Factors include the current condition of the floor, desired wood type, and the compatibility with existing interior design.
How does the replacement process typically work? It involves removing the old flooring, preparing the subfloor, and installing the new wood planks securely for a durable finish.
